Saturn in Pisces

 

Saturn enters Pisces on March 7, 2023 and will remain there until February 14, 2026. Interestingly, the archetypes of Saturn and Pisces are vastly paradoxical. Saturn is largely rigid and demands a solid structure, whereas Pisces is an ethereal archetype that represents the spiritual consciousness of having no boundaries. The very concept of reality may become slippery as we do our best to grasp Saturn’s lessons of compassion and healing in the complex ocean of Pisces. Clarity may elude us, making it necessary for us to get comfortable with not having all the answers.

While Saturn was in Aquarius from 2020-2023, we experienced numerous global challenges and various forms of societal limitations. In Aquarius, Saturn was in the element of fixed air, which largely manifested as boisterous opinions and inflexible beliefs. However, in Pisces, Saturn transitions into mutable water, shifting the focus away from the mind and toward our innate emotional sensitivity that is always responding to the ever-changing tides of life. If dissociation was a prime coping mechanism in Aquarius, then Saturn in Pisces is likely to force us to face the consequences of that reality. It is now that we may become acutely aware of the emotional and spiritual healing necessitated by the trauma we have endured.

In astrology Pisces is co-ruled by Jupiter and Neptune. This means that Saturn will be working to serve the goals and functions of these two ruling planets while in Pisces. For example, Jupiter pushes us to have faith and grow outside of our comfort zone, while Neptune links us to vulnerability and creativity. We can confidently expect to be challenged to evolve and build stronger foundations in these areas that are practical and rooted in physical reality rather than sourcing our spirituality from overly cerebral concepts or deceptive gurus.

On April 14, shortly after entering Pisces, Saturn will sextile the North Node in Taurus. This aspect may offer a glimpse of what kind of growth is possible for the future when we are willing to see the truth of a situation. This aspect may provide creative solutions that help us break through challenges toward a new grounded vision for the future, should we be prepared to meet reality with no goal of escaping it.

The midpoint of 2023 will see an especially active Saturn. On June 17, Saturn stations retrograde at the seventh degree of Pisces and begins a five-month period of revision and review until November 4. This time will invite us to contemplate the dose of tough love we’ve received from Saturn since March. The house ruled by Pisces in our chart will be under heavy construction, with the retrograde period allowing for adjustments and reconsiderations to be made as we begin to understand the work that is cut out for us.

Just days after Saturn stations retrograde, Jupiter in Taurus will sextile Saturn in Pisces on June 19. This energy can be refreshing, as Jupiter’s propensity for optimism mixes creatively with Saturn’s inclination toward hard work. As we experience potential growth in the house ruled by Taurus, we may feel more inspired to roll up our sleeves and get to work in the house ruled by Pisces in our chart.
